STERICYCLE ($NASDAQ:SRCL) is a publicly traded company listed on the NASDAQ stock exchange. It is a leader in the medical waste management industry providing a range of services to healthcare institutions and organizations. Their services include hazardous waste management, compliance training and consulting services, and waste disposal and recycling solutions. – Waste Connections Inc ($NYSE:WCN)
Waste Connections Inc is a publicly traded company that provides waste management and environmental services in the United States, Canada, and Mexico. The company has a market capitalization of $33.42 billion as of April 2021 and a return on equity of 9.38%. Waste Connections Inc is the third largest waste management company in North America by revenue. The company’s main services include residential, commercial, and industrial waste collection; landfill operations; and recycling and resource recovery.
– Waste Management Inc ($NYSE:WM)
Waste Management Inc is a leading provider of comprehensive waste management services in North America. The company’s operations include solid waste collection, transfer, disposal, and recycling. Waste Management serves residential, commercial, industrial, and municipal customers in the United States and Canada.
Waste Management has a market capitalization of $63.71 billion as of 2022 and a return on equity of 28.78%.
